Where Style Consistency Breaks
Shonen manga relies on a very specific visual language: bold line weights for foreground action and thinner, cleaner lines for character expressions. Most style transfer systems fail because they treat every pixel with equal importance. Without a dedicated understanding of comic anatomy, these tools blur the distinction between a character's silhouette and the background environment, leading to a loss of the depth necessary for the vertical comic platforms format.

When you move your characters across different camera angles, you are the guardian of their design integrity. If your AI model hallucinates a new hairstyle or changes the length of a hero’s iconic scarf mid-fight, your reader is immediately pulled out of the immersion. Traditional AI tools often struggle with "model drift," where the output looks similar enough to satisfy a casual observer but is visibly wrong to a loyal reader.
- Chapter cadence. Use the AI pass for pages where speed matters most, such as repeated action poses, transformation beats, or dense speed-line panels. Keep manual cleanup for hero panels where the line style defines the emotional peak.
- Character continuity. Compare the generated lines against the same model sheet, costume notes, and facial-expression range used during sketching. This prevents a fast inking pass from drifting away from the character identity readers recognize.
- Export readiness. Check whether the Color webtoon can move into lettering, coloring, or final layout without rebuilding panel borders or speech-bubble space. A good Shonen workflow should save time while keeping the next production step predictable.

Creators should define the scene goal, character references, page count, reading direction, and target Color vertical comic platforms. That gives AI Manga Style Transfer enough context to support the story instead of producing disconnected panels. For visual quality, creators should check line weight, facial expression, pose clarity, panel order, and space for dialogue before export. Those checks matter more for Shonen pages because action beats and emotional pauses need to read quickly.
